How to serve G.D. Vajra Langhe Nebbiolo
Allow 65 minutes from open to pour.
- Open and decant. Open 60 minutes before serving and pour into a decanter to aerate.
- Serve at 14-16°C. Cellar temperature (14-16°C) is the band for this style. Warmer pushes alcohol forward; colder dampens aromatics.
- Glassware. Use a Burgundy bowl with a wide opening: the bowl shape rewards the wine's structure.
- Pair with. Tajarin with ragu, Roast chicken, Salumi platter. Match the wine's structure to the dish's fat and salt.

Frequently asked about G.D. Vajra Langhe Nebbiolo
What does G.D. Vajra Langhe Nebbiolo taste like?
Structurally medium-bodied, medium tannins, high acidity with a long finish. Vajra's Langhe Nebbiolo is a fresh, fragrant and early-drinking introduction to the grape, drawn from younger vines around Vergne.
When should I drink G.D. Vajra Langhe Nebbiolo?
Drink 2 to 8 from vintage. Young vintages benefit from 30-90 minutes of decanting; mature bottles should be handled carefully for sediment.
What food pairs with G.D. Vajra Langhe Nebbiolo?
Tajarin with ragu is the canonical pairing. Other strong matches include Roast chicken and Salumi platter. Round tannin and red fruit carry the meat sauce.
What grapes are in G.D. Vajra Langhe Nebbiolo?
The blend is Nebbiolo (100%). The wine is classified as Langhe Nebbiolo DOC.
